TOP 5Holiday GIFTS for Elderly Loved Ones With all the hustle and bustle of the holiday season it can be hard to come up with the perfect gift ideas for elderly loved ones.
Here are Our Top 5…
#1 Help Your Elderly Loved One Relive Their Childhood
Childhood memories are often some of our fondest. Look for a gift that takes your loved one back to their happiest moments as a child…
Games, historical books or a favorite childhood movie remastered are just a few gifts that can help someone relive their favorite childhood experiences.
#2 Help Your Loved One Relive Their Heyday
Like childhood memories, gifts that help an elderly loved one relive their prime are also a great choice.
I got my Dad who was a recreational pilot a picture book of airplane history. He couldn’t stop talking about his fantastic gift.
And nearly everyone at the assisted living residence heard about it too !
#3 Give A Life Experience Gifts don’t have to be physical things… Giving someone an experience they’ve never had is one of the most long lasting presents you can give and many will cherish the memory forever.
A short trip to a national park, a senior swimming class or a spa pamper package are all fantastic ideas. Don’t forget to choose an activity they’ve never done before.
#4 The Gift of Time
Often the most valuable thing we can give someone is the gift of our own time.
For example, you could give a voucher to a senior who would really appreciate some help around the house.
Or, if you’re good with technical things you could give a “fix it” voucher to a senior to call you when they need help with a computer, cell phone or TV.
#5 Give the Gift of Family History
Most people’s knowledge of their family history is limited. Take a look at the leading ancestry websites and test kits to determine one’s true family history.
It can be a real fun and eye opening experience for them and the whole family.
